Graduate DIONNE KITCHING recently exhibited as part of COME TOGETHER, the latest exhibition by the AOI at The Printspace Gallery. From two individuals in an intimate embrace, or crowds joining in the celebration, the show featuered work celebrating what it means to be together in our world.

This September the HOUSE OF ILLUSTRATION asked artists and illustrators to do a one-inch drawing for each day of the month inspired by John Vernon Lord who, in 2016, did a drawing for every single day of the year.

Several of our students took on the 30 day challenge including ELLEN KNOWLES  and LORRAINE ANSELL– bellow are some of the illustrations they created for the brief;

Since 2012 SECRET 7″ has held an open competiton, inviting artists to create sleeve artwork for seven selected tracks. Out of these 700  will be selected and exhibited with the records and their illustrated sleeves being sold for a chosen charity.

We are delighted to say that gaduates JAMES BOAST, CHARLOT KRISTENSEN and LUKE SPICER were all selected for this year’s show. You can check out their illustrations below;

We are delighted to announce that 3rd year student COURTENEY HORAN has been selected as one of the winners of this year’s D&AD Hotel Indigo Brief for her Behind the Suite concept. Drawing on the rich cultural history of the lower East Side, this concept sees images from the city’s past projected onto the faces of the hotels. Below are the full set of illustration;
